On November 16th, 2025, the Arkansas Mediation Center announced the launch of their new virtual mediation services in response to the increasing demand for remote conflict resolution options. The center, which has been providing mediation services to individuals and businesses across the state for over a decade, hopes that the introduction of virtual mediation will make their services more accessible and convenient for clients.With the ongoing Covid-19 pandemic leading to restrictions on in-person gatherings and meetings, many individuals and businesses have had to turn to alternative methods of conflict resolution. The Arkansas Mediation Center recognized this need and worked quickly to develop a secure and user-friendly platform for virtual mediations.The new virtual mediation services will allow clients to participate in mediation sessions from the comfort of their own homes or offices, eliminating the need for travel and allowing for greater flexibility in scheduling. Clients will be able to connect with their mediator via video conferencing software, where they can discuss and work through their issues in a collaborative and confidential environment.The Arkansas Mediation Center is optimistic about the impact that virtual mediation will have on their clients, stating that it will provide a more efficient and cost-effective way to resolve disputes. They believe that the convenience of virtual mediation will encourage more individuals and businesses to seek out their services, ultimately leading to more successful outcomes for all parties involved.In addition to the introduction of virtual mediation services, the Arkansas Mediation Center also announced plans to expand their team of mediators to keep up with the growing demand for their services. They hope to recruit mediators with a diverse range of expertise and backgrounds to better serve their clients and provide them with the highest level of support possible.Overall, the Arkansas Mediation Center's decision to launch virtual mediation services marks an important step forward in the world of conflict resolution. By adapting to the changing needs of their clients and embracing new technologies, they are ensuring that they can continue to provide effective and accessible mediation services for years to come.
